Scofield council votes to prohibit mineral extraction in agricultural zone
Summary
The council unanimously amended the Scofield land-use code to change extraction/mining of sand, gravel and similar resources from 'allowed by special use permit' to 'not allowed' in the agricultural zone. The motion passed by roll call with all present councilmembers voting in favor.
The Scofield Town Council voted May 19 to amend its land-use code to prohibit extraction and mining activities in the town’s agricultural zone. The change amends Table 2, use 1.32, removing extraction of sand, gravel, earthstone, minerals, petroleum and similar resources as a use that could be allowed by special-use permit.
